The biggest problem I've seen with the projects being discussed here
in this news group is that there is no clear plan on what the end
product is going to be. Without a clear plan about what you want to
accomplish you'll end up running into lots of problems each time the
design changes after you've already got part of a design done. And
without a definite plan, there will be a lot of design changes.
